Trying to develop a good 40# chip for my modded Syclone, 749 ECU.  Mods =
heads, cam, turbo and all the hardware needed to monitor stuff and to
assure adequate fuel flow.

Started w/ a good 18# 3 bar strip chip, was running fairly well; did the
cam & heads & turbo upgrade (21g comp x 10cm° turbine).

First off, burned a bunch of chips changing only the BPW vs EGR value @ 0°
desired EGR - all the other values zeroed for simplicity, no EGR's going to
be used anyhow.  Closest thing to an injector constant, I'm told.  BTW,
zeroing the "Injector constant" value in the 749 has *no* effect on anyting
- apparently the code doesn't use it.

The value that gave the best combo of idle quality & cruise INT closest to
128 turned out to be 0.94.  I was using 44# base FP, but was getting
constant knock above 4800 rpms, 18# boost; injector duty cycle was 100%.
This is probably a bassackwards way to start, WOT stuff, but caution was
observed, nothing broke.  Reason I did this was that I figured the FP gives
a nice, straight "curve" to the fueling (actually flat curve), so was the
place to start.  Do everything else, find oyt the WOT fuel's inadequate,
start over.  Phooy.

Raised the FP to 48#, which should give a 6% increase in flow.  High rpm
knock down to 2°.  Ok, I like that.  Now, seems to me the next table to
adjust is the F30, VE vs RPM, for a broad "overall" curve.  The injectors
turned out to be quite "fat" down low, so VE's @ 0, 400 & 800 RPMs were
reduced so's to get around 128 INT @ idle.  Starting was crappy, needed to
richen up the CRANK A/F to get decent starts.  The reduced F30 value @ 0
RPM probably partially caused this.  Raised VEs @ around 3200 - 3600 RPMs,
figuring this was the approximate torque peak; tailed off from there, from
4000 up, figuring torque was past, flow probably falling somewhat.  This
table, I figure, should somewhat resemble a smooth curve.  ?????

Next to do is the VE vs RPM vs MAP table; my thinking is that this will
provide the narrow band "tweaks" needed here and there to get good throttle
response, off idle, etc.  Working on this part now.

Got a question: if the VE vs RPM vs MAP table apparently covers just about
every situation, of what use is the "Base boost multiplier vs MAP" table?
